The Role

Do you enjoy being hands-on in a fast-paced environment, reading orders, and working with a team? We are looking for a Fulfillment Associate! You will be responsible for bringing customer orders to life. The associate will be able to work in a fast-paced environment while maintaining attention to detail; and maintaining our safety, quality, and outstanding customer service culture. Do you have what it takes?

Range:$17.00 - $17.00

Here's what a day at work looks like...

  • Pull, pack, and ship orders
  • Print orders
  • Organize products for shipment
  • Label product
  • Box making
  • Maintain a positive attitude and a good work ethic

About you…

  • High School Diploma or higher.
  • Computer Savvy
  • Able to stand/walk for 8-10 hours
  • Sense of urgency and detail-oriented
  • Ability to continuously climb and descend ladders safely
  • Productive, dependable, flexible, and punctual
  • Think outside the box (bring innovative ideas to our e-commerce warehouse)

It would be great but not completely necessary to have…

  • Order fulfillment experience
  • Experience working with a growing company

Shoe Palace is one of the most-trusted athletic footwear and apparel retail chains in the United States. What began as a small, family business in 1993 has now grown into an extremely popular chain of stores and an online retail site — shoepalace.com.
